Journal of Child and Family Studies is a quarterly peer-reviewed academic journal published by Springer Science+Business Media that focuses on family child, adolescent, and family psychology. The editors-in-chief are Cheri J. Shapiro and Anne F. Farrell.

According to the Journal Citation Reports, the journal has a 2019 impact factor of 1.310.[1]
